A255744 a(1) = 1; for n > 1, a(n) = 10*9^(A000120(n-1)-1).

Original entry on oeis.org

1, 10, 10, 90, 10, 90, 90, 810, 10, 90, 90, 810, 90, 810, 810, 7290, 10, 90, 90, 810, 90, 810, 810, 7290, 90, 810, 810, 7290, 810, 7290, 7290, 65610, 10, 90, 90, 810, 90, 810, 810, 7290, 90, 810, 810, 7290, 810, 7290, 7290, 65610, 90, 810, 810, 7290, 810, 7290

Comments

Also, this is a row of the square array A255740.
Partial sums give A255765.

Examples

			Also, written as an irregular triangle in which the row lengths are the terms of A011782, the sequence begins:
1;
10;
10, 90;
10, 90, 90, 810;
10, 90, 90, 810, 90, 810, 810, 7290;
...
